8.

PROPOSED LISTING CONSULTATION FROM HISTORIC ENGLAND pdf icon PDF 662 KB

To consider whether the two sites of interest detailed in the “Proposal” have architectural or historic interest. 

Decision:

The Committee received a report in relation to a proposed listing consultation from Historic England. The Development Manager explained that Historic England was considering whether the following two sites had special architectural or historic interest:

 

·       Scenes of Everyday Life by William Mitchell, Park Place, underpass.

·       Former Co-operative house (now Primark) including mural by Gyula Bajo of CWS architects’ Department.

 

Members were in support of the proposal on the grounds that both sites worth preserving given the history of mural and the significant piece of artwork.

 

It was RESOLVED that the proposed listing consultation from Historic England be noted. 

 

9.

STREET NAMING AND NUMBERING APPROVED LIST pdf icon PDF 199 KB

To consider the attached list of street names for Stevenage following both existing being used and new names being suggested.

 

Additional documents:

Decision:

The Committee received an updated list of street names for Stevenage. The list was approved by the Name and Numbering Committee, and all Members consultation took place in summer 2021.

 

Members agreed that the street names should be gender balanced and culturally diverse.

 

It was RESOLVED that the Street Naming and Numbering list be noted.
